Position

White: king h6; pawns b4/g6/h2. Black: king a3; bishop e4; pawn b6. Black is ahead by 1 point of material. White to move.

Solution (6 moves)

  1. Opponent setup: Bxg6 — bishop e4→g6, captures pawn. Now White to move.
  2. Best move: Kxg6 — king h6→g6, captures bishop. Opponent replies Kxb4 (king a3→b4, captures pawn).
  3. Best move: h4 — pawn h2→h4. Opponent replies b5 (pawn b6→b5).
  4. Best move: h5 — pawn h4→h5. Opponent replies Kc5 (king b4→c5).
  5. Best move: h6 — pawn h5→h6. Opponent replies b4 (pawn b5→b4).
  6. Best move: h7 — pawn h6→h7. Opponent replies b3 (pawn b4→b3).
  7. Best move: h8=Q — pawn h7→h8, promotes to queen.

Tactical themes

advanced pawn, crushing, endgame, promotion, quiet move, very long. The key move Kxg6 wins material.
